On Tuesday July 17, 2007, the independent professional baseball league Continental Baseball League ran its first All-Star Game. The two teams were the North (comprised of the Lewisville Lizards and Tarrant County Blue Thunder) and the South (comprised of the Bay Area Toros & Texas Heat). The North defeated the South by a final score of 7-2.

Karl Krailo (Tarrant County Blue Thunder) was the All-Star Game MVP.

Photos are from the All-Star Game that evening. The previous evening (Monday July 16, 2007) had the CBL's first home-run derby event, won by Toros' player Noah Scott.
